Assam: Traffic Suraksha Enforcers help in realising fines, reducing road mishaps in Hailakandi

Hailakandi:  The District Transport authorities here have collected Rs.2.54 lakh by way of fines in the past two months, thanks to Traffic Suraksha Enforcers.

District Transport Officer, Syed Rafiqul Mannan said the amount has been realised by way of fines following the launching of Traffic Suraksha Enforcers WhatsApp Group where the public report on traffic violations by way of photos and videos. The group was floated on June 27.

“0n receiving a photo of traffic rules violation, we initiate action by sending a challan to the registered owner of the vehicle stating the penalty provision and fine. This has not only led to realisation of fines but also most importantly in reducing traffic mishaps and fatalities,” quipped Mannan.

The transport authorities here in order to increase the number of participants organised a competition with cash prizes to the sender of highest photographs.

1,739 actionable photographs on traffic violations were received with 98 users taking part in the competition. The names undisclosed of the first, second and third prize winners have been announced on August 31. The first prize winner for Rs.5,000 sent 515 photographs followed by the second prize winner for Rs 3,000 with 411 photographs and the third prize winner for Rs.2,000 with 239 photographs.

The authorities are planning to give away the prizes to the winners in the next meeting of the District Road Safety Committee.
